Just nu i M3-nätverket
Jump to content

Välja vilka länkar som skall skapas från databas


rekan

Recommended Posts

Jag skall presentera en blogg och jag sparar textID, rubrik, text, datum i en databas.

Koden för att presentera den senaste bloggen samt att skapa länkar till alla andra bloggar ser ut så här:

 

$sql1 = "SELECT * FROM tabell ORDER BY textID DESC LIMIT 0,1";

$result1 = mysql_query("$sql1");

$forstarad = mysql_fetch_array($result1);

$id = $forstarad['textID']; //för att denna inte skall synas i länklisten nedan.

 

print $forstarad['rubrik'] . "&nbsp" . $forstarad['datum'] . "<br>" . forstarad['text'];

 

print "Tidigare bloggar: ";

 

$sql2 = "SELECT textID, rubrik, datum FROM tabell WHERE $id != textID ORDER BY textID DESC";

$result2 = mysql_query("$sql2");

 

while($rad = mysql_fetch_array($result2)){

$lank = $rad['rubrik'] . $rad['datum'] . "<br>";

print '<a href="">' . $lank . '</a>'; //Hur skall jag skapa länken?

}

 

Som ni ser så hänvisar länken inte till något. Koden ligger i blogg.php och mitt problem är att jag inte vet hur jag skall skapa länkarna så att jag kan öppna den blogg jag vill. Helst skall ju inte den öppnade bloggen synas i listan med länkar heller.

 

/Fredrik

 

[inlägget ändrat 2006-01-27 14:26:39 av rekan8]

Link to comment
Share on other sites

Jag förstår inte riktigt ditt problem?

 

print '<a href="">' . $lank . '</a>'; //Hur skall jag skapa länken?

 

Det ska alltså se ut som:

 

print '<a href="'.$lank.'">' . $lank . '</a>'; //Hur skall jag skapa länken?

 

.. För att en länk ska peka någonstans.

 

Du har ingen href i "" delen där. Men vad du menar med att den öppnade bloggen inte ska synas i listan förstår jag inte riktigt. Kan du ta en screenshot och peka ut vad det är du vill ha?

 

 

 

Link to comment
Share on other sites

Ok jag skall försöka förtydliga mitt problem lite.

Jag vill alltså välja ut alla texter ur en tabell. Förrutom texterna lagras textID, rubrik och datum. Den senast inskrivna texten skall visas i sin helhet och under den skall alla de andra texterna presenteras som länkar med rubrik och datum. När jag sedan trycker på en av de tidigare texterna (länkarna) så är det denna som skall visas i sin helhet och den som syntes förrut skall synas bland länkarna. Den texten som nu syns skall också försvinna från länkarna.

 

 

text1 060110

blabla blabla blabla blabla blabla blabla

blabla blabla blabla

blabla blabla

blabla

 

text2(länk) 060101

 

text3(länk) 051224

osv...

 

 

Om jag följer text2 så blir resultatet alltså

 

text2 060101

blabla blabla blabla blabla blabla blabla

blabla blabla blabla

blabla blabla

blabla

 

text1(länk) 060110

 

text3(länk) 051224

osv...

 

Var detta tydligare?

 

/Fredrik

 

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.



×
×
  • Create New...